  1. Jason Barr, listed at 6'5" and 195 lbs, tall and lanky, has a large step towards the plate, which may make his fastball appear to reach the batters a bit quicker than most. He threw 51 of 74 pitches for strikes, mixing his fastball (topping at 91 MPH to start, but hitting 89 in the 6th inning) with an offspeed pitch at 81 and a nice curve in the mid 70's. He was assisted by two double plays. All the Giants pitchers worked quickly with the game lasting only 2 hours and 18 minutes. Nolan Riggs is a large man - 6'8" and 255 lbs. His fastball reached 93 MPH as he struck out 5 of his 6 batters. Van Horn's home run was a no-doubter to left center field. He also drove in a run with a ground out after Fargas reached on an error and then stole both second and third. APGiantsfan
